Episode 850: The Powerless Paradox - When Recovery's First Step Goes Wrong | Riverside Recovery Of TampaWhat if the very first step in most addiction recovery programs could actually set some people up to fail? It's a provocative question that challenges one of recovery's most fundamental principles. In this episode of The Behavioral Health Answers Podcast, we explore How Does Admitting "Powerlessness" Work Against Us? and examine whether this well-intentioned approach might inadvertently reinforce the very feelings that fuel addiction in the first place.In this episode, we discuss:• The traditional 12-step model's emphasis on admitting powerlessness over addiction• How feelings of weakness and helplessness can create a dangerous feedback loop that feeds addiction• The critical difference between admitting powerlessness versus acknowledging your illness• The empowerment mindset as an alternative approach that focuses on inner strength and fighting back• Practical steps for shifting from "I can't" to "I can" in recovery and beyondThis episode emphasizes an important takeaway: while admitting powerlessness has helped millions find their path to recovery, some individuals may benefit more from an empowerment-based approach that reclaims their inner strength rather than reinforcing feelings of weakness. Recovery isn't one-size-fits-all, and understanding different pathways can make all the difference in finding what truly works for each person's healing journey.This podcast is for educational and informational purposes only and is not a substitute for professional medical, mental health, or legal advice.
